schema_version: "1.0"
workflow:
id: "speckit"
name: "Full SDD Cycle"
version: "1.0.0"
author: "GitHub"
description: "Runs specify → plan → tasks → implement with review gates"
requires:
# 0.8.5 is the first release with engine-side resolution of the
# ``integration: "auto"`` default. Older versions would treat "auto"
# as a literal integration key and fail at dispatch.
speckit_version: ">=0.8.5"
integrations:
# The four commands below (specify, plan, tasks, implement) are core
# spec-kit commands provided by every integration. The list here is an
# advisory, non-exhaustive compatibility hint following the documented
# ``any: [...]`` schema -- it is NOT a closed set. The workflow runs
# against any integration the project was initialized with, including
# ones not listed below, as long as that integration provides the four
# core commands referenced in ``steps``.
any:
- "claude"
- "copilot"
- "gemini"
- "opencode"
inputs:
spec:
type: string
required: true
prompt: "Describe what you want to build"
integration:
type: string
default: "auto"
prompt: "Integration to use (e.g. claude, copilot, gemini; 'auto' uses the project's initialized integration)"
scope:
type: string
default: "full"
enum: ["full", "backend-only", "frontend-only"]
steps:
- id: specify
command: speckit.specify
integration: "{{ inputs.integration }}"
input:
args: "{{ inputs.spec }}"
- id: review-spec
type: gate
message: "Review the generated spec before planning."
options: [approve, reject]
on_reject: abort
- id: plan
command: speckit.plan
integration: "{{ inputs.integration }}"
input:
args: "{{ inputs.spec }}"
- id: review-plan
type: gate
message: "Review the plan before generating tasks."
options: [approve, reject]
on_reject: abort
- id: tasks
command: speckit.tasks
integration: "{{ inputs.integration }}"
input:
args: "{{ inputs.spec }}"
- id: implement
command: speckit.implement
integration: "{{ inputs.integration }}"
input:
args: "{{ inputs.spec }}"
